I am the author of suspense fiction with a twist, Pork.
PORK_3Dsmall.jpg
PORK_3Dsmall.jpg (31.36 KiB) Viewed 1712 times
High school is torture for Steven Walthurst, and home isn’t a whole lot better. The only place that offers respite is an abandoned tree house at the edge of town. But something lurks in the nearby woods, and the long line of elm trees has a clear message for Steven: keep out.

Then one day, Steven finds a little girl lying unconscious, perilously close to the woods. As the two get to know one another, Steven experiences real friendship for the first time—and gets closer than ever to knowing the darkness that skulks between the trees.

He dedicates himself to keeping his new friend safe, but the tranquility of their fragile hidden world doesn’t last long. When an act of cruelty pushes Steven to his limits, his secrets—and those of the dark woods—come close to unraveling, threatening to destroy the one thing making his teenage life bearable.

Can Steven save everything he’s built from crumbling under the pressure?

I finished reading Pork several days ago.

It's ok for a novella. I didn't find it exciting. However, I'm not the target audience for it.

It's well written. I mean, it's written well enough to hold my attention. There are no holes in the writing, meaning, the scenes flowed well from one to another. The action flowed well too.

Too little happened in the novella. I felt like the only notable events that happened was when the treehouse burned and the very end of the whole thing.
